Think of it, we all know already how conventional dating sites work: Active men are more than women, men message women, women get overwhelmed by the load of messages and skip the uglies and only reply to the most good looking and best profiles.

So women are already in control in conventional dating sites and only the top men are making it, so why not saving time for both genders? With my concept, the women are no longer gonna waste time by filtering their inbox and many men would no longer waste time on sending messages hoping to get a single reply.

In both cases, only the top men would make it but in my concept it would save the time of those who don't often make it, instead they would invest their time in improving and crafting their profiles - that wouldn't be as time consuming as emailing well crafted custom messages though.

Some might think this concept would deprive men the power of choice while giving it fully to women but I think it might balance the power of choosing: Women on a such site would be less likely to develop a God's gift complex (since they're not getting infinite initiative attention there) and some might even get a blow to their ego once the hot male supermodels they messaged ignored them (since they are receiving too many messages) therefore they would humble their standards and go messaging non-supermodels, as result that would give the average good-looking more power of choice there than the regular dating site. The women would even feel more challenged to get the attention of some guys, making them wanting to revisit the site.

So that would make the portion of 'top men' larger there.

One downside with such website would be attracting spams to create fake female profile to fraud males there, it would require good moderation and verification to prevent that.
